Generating form-based user interfaces for XML vocabularies

So far, many user interfaces for XML data (documents) have been constructed from scratch for specific XML vocabularies and applications. The tool support for user interfaces for XML data is inadequate. Forms-XML is an interactive component invoked by applications for generating user interfaces for prescribed XML vocabularies automatically. Based on a given XML schema, the component generates a hierarchy of HTML forms for users to interact with and update XML data compliant with the given schema. The user interface Forms-XML generates is very simple with an abundance of guidance and hints to the user, and can be customized by user interface designers as well as developers.

[1]  Vincent Quint,et al.  Interactively Editing Structured Documents , 1989, Electron. Publ..

[2]  Yue-Sun Kuo,et al.  Avoiding Syntactic Violations in Forms-XML , 2004, Extreme Markup Languages®.

[3]  Vincent Quint,et al.  Techniques for authoring complex XML documents , 2004, DocEng '04.

[4]  Yue-Sun Kuo,et al.  Handling syntactic constraints in a DTD-compliant XML editor , 2003, DocEng '03.

[5]  W. Glas Xml and Databases , 2002 .

[6]  Paolo Atzeni,et al.  XML AND DATABASES , 2004 .